About the Edgewood market
What is the median home price in Edgewood, RI?
The median sale price in Edgewood, RI is $471,667 (data through July 2026), based on deeds recorded with the county. That is down 7.3% from a year earlier.
How many homes sell in Edgewood, RI each year?
91 homes sold in Edgewood, RI over the last 12 months (data through July 2026). TopHap counts recorded arm's-length deeds, not listings, so the figure is not affected by which brokerage handled the sale.
Is Edgewood, RI a buyer's or seller's market?
Edgewood, RI is currently a buyer's market, scoring 38 out of 100 on TopHap's market temperature index (data through July 2026). The score weighs sales velocity and price direction; above 60 favours sellers, below 40 favours buyers.
How many homes are there in Edgewood, RI?
Edgewood, RI contains 2,587 residential properties, with a median of 1,660 square feet, 3 bedrooms, built around 1920. The median TopHap Estimate is $470K.
How does Edgewood, RI compare to the rest of Providence County?
By median home value, Edgewood, RI is the 9th most expensive of 35 neighborhoods in Providence County. Its typical home is worth more than 57% of all homes in Providence County. Mount Hope ranks just above it and Elmhurst just below. The ranking is rebuilt nightly from the county assessor record of every home in each area.
Do people own or rent in Edgewood, RI?
80% of homes in Edgewood, RI are owner-occupied. 9% are held by a company rather than an individual.
How much equity do owners in Edgewood, RI hold?
60% of mortgaged homes in Edgewood, RI are equity-rich, meaning the loan balance is under half the home's value. 0.7% owe more than the home is worth.
